英英释义
delightful
adj.greatly pleasing or entertaining
"a delightful surprise"; "the comedy was delightful"
同义词:delicious
同近义词辨析
joyful, glad, delightful, merry, gay, happy, agreeable, jolly, nice, pleasant, cheerful这组词都有“愉快的,高兴的”的意思,其区别是:
joyful语气较强,强调心情或感情上的欣喜。
glad最普通用词,语气较弱,表示礼貌的惯用语。指乐于做某事或因某事而感到满足,常表愉快的心情。
delightful指能带来强烈的快乐,激起愉快的情感,用于非常愉快的场合。
merry指精神情绪的暂时高涨,表示欢乐、愉快的心境或情景,侧重充满欢笑声和乐趣。
gay侧重无忧无虑、精神昂扬、充满生命的快乐。
happy侧重感到满足、幸福或高兴。
agreeable指与感受者的愿望、情趣或受好等和谐一致而带来的心情上的快意。
jolly通俗用词,多指充满快乐与喜悦的神情。
nice语气较温和,泛指任何愉快或满意的感觉。
pleasant侧重给人以“赏心悦目”或“愉快的,宜人的”感受。
cheerful多指因内心的愉快而表现出兴高采烈,是强调而自然的感情流露。
